Independent risk factors of COVID-19 pneumonia in vaccinated Mexican adults

Abstract
Objective: To evaluate host factors associated with the risk of coronavirus disease 2019 (COVID-19) pneumonia in vaccinated adults.
Methods: A cohort study was conducted in Mexico, and data from 1,607 adults with confirmed illness, with a positive history of COVID-19 vaccination, were analyzed. Risk ratios (RR) and 95% confidence intervals (CI) were computed as a measure of the significance of the associations between putative risk factors and the prevalence of COVID-19 pneumonia in vaccinated subjects.
Results: The overall risk of pneumonia was 1.98 per 1,000 person-days. In the multiple regression analysis, older subjects and those with a history of smoking (current), obesity, and type 2 diabetes mellitus were at increased risk of pneumonia.
Conclusions: Our results suggest that the effectiveness of COVID-19 vaccines may be reduced in a subset of adults who are elderly, or are smokers, obese or have type 2 diabetes mellitus.
